Albumin Market Outlook: Size, Share, Trends, Growth Analysis, Competitive Landscape & Forecast, 2026-2033

The Albumin Market size was valued at US$ 7.81 billion in 2025 and is projected to reach US$ 14.26 billion by 2033, growing at a CAGR of 7.82% during 2026–2033. Rising demand for plasma-derived therapeutics, expanding critical care applications, and increasing use of albumin in biopharmaceutical manufacturing continue to support sustained market development.

Product

The product segment forms the backbone of commercial albumin production as manufacturers continue expanding plasma-derived and recombinant technologies to meet growing clinical and research requirements. It accounted for 69%–72% market share in 2025 and is projected to register a CAGR of 7.8%–8.3% during 2026–2033. Increasing therapeutic demand, technological advancements, and broader biologics production continue to strengthen the Albumin Market scope, encouraging investment in high-purity and scalable albumin manufacturing.

  • Human Serum Albumin: Remains the dominant product owing to extensive clinical use in trauma care, liver disease management, hypovolemia treatment, burns, and critical care procedures requiring plasma volume expansion.
  • Recombinant Albumin: Adoption continues increasing across biologics manufacturing, vaccine production, regenerative medicine, and cell culture applications because of consistent quality, animal-free production, and reduced contamination risks.
  • Bovine Serum Albumin: Widely utilized in diagnostic kits, laboratory research, protein stabilization, immunoassays, and biotechnology applications where reliable biochemical performance and cost efficiency remain essential.

Application

Application diversity continues expanding as albumin products support therapeutic care, pharmaceutical development, and advanced biomedical research. The segment represented 58%–61% market share in 2025 and is expected to grow at a CAGR of 8.0%–8.5% through 2026–2033. Rising healthcare expenditure and continuous innovation in biologic medicines are supporting broader adoption across multiple clinical and scientific disciplines.

  • Therapeutics: Represents the largest application, supporting treatment of liver disorders, burns, shock, sepsis, trauma, hypoalbuminemia, and other critical care conditions requiring plasma volume restoration.
  • Diagnostics: Utilized in clinical laboratory testing, reagent preparation, diagnostic assay development, and quality control processes where protein stability and analytical accuracy are important.
  • Research: Increasingly adopted in cell culture media, vaccine development, drug discovery, molecular biology, and life science research because of its excellent stabilizing and binding properties.

Key Market Drivers

Rising demand for plasma-derived therapeutics

The rising instances of chronic liver diseases, immune deficiency diseases, severe burns, trauma cases, and critical conditions are expected to keep up the demand for therapeutic products derived from plasma across the globe. Albumin is a vital plasma protein, which is used to replenish the volume of the blood. As per the World Health Organization, initiatives related to blood and plasma donation are being expanded across the world to ensure availability of plasma-derived therapies. Growing therapeutic utilization across hospitals and specialty care centers continues supporting Albumin Market growth, encouraging manufacturers to strengthen plasma collection networks and invest in advanced fractionation technologies.

Growing use in critical care treatments

Critical care units increasingly depend on albumin for managing hypovolemia, septic shock, liver cirrhosis, major surgeries, and intensive care procedures. Healthcare providers value albumin because of its ability to maintain oncotic pressure and improve circulatory stability in complex clinical conditions. Rising hospital admissions associated with chronic diseases and aging populations are contributing to sustained product demand. Clinical guideline updates supporting evidence-based albumin therapy continue encouraging healthcare institutions to expand procurement of plasma-derived products for emergency and intensive care settings.

Increasing applications in biopharmaceutical production

Biopharmaceutical companies have found increasing applications of albumin in stabilizing vaccines and other biologics such as recombinant proteins and monoclonal antibodies. The growing research on cell and gene therapy is one reason for increasing demand for recombinant albumin. Pharmaceutical companies are still making efforts to innovate new manufacturing technologies. These developments are reshaping Albumin Market trends, creating new commercial opportunities beyond conventional plasma-derived therapeutic applications while supporting rapid growth in biologics manufacturing worldwide.

Market Restraints and Challenges

Limited plasma supply affects production capacity

Plasma-derived albumin manufacturing depends heavily on consistent plasma donations, making supply availability a significant industry challenge. Factor: Fluctuations in plasma collection volumes, donor participation, and collection infrastructure can restrict raw material availability for fractionation facilities. Impact: Limited amount of plasma restricts production capacity, delays product delivery time, and leads to increased costs of sourcing material, making it hard for producers to cope with increasing demand for therapeutic products.

High manufacturing costs reduce profitability

Albumin production requires sophisticated fractionation technologies, strict quality control systems, advanced purification processes, and compliance with stringent regulatory standards. Factor: High operational expenses, specialized production facilities, and continuous regulatory validation substantially increase manufacturing costs. Impact: Increased cost of production lowers profit margin especially for small producers; additionally, there is no flexibility with regards to pricing and increased barriers to entry. Firms still invest in process engineering and recombinant technology for enhanced efficiency and reduced cost of production in the long-run.
